Welcome to the air conditioning guide for Black Hill, located in postcode 2322. Using the nearest weather station data from NEWCASTLE UNIVERSITY at an elevation of 21 metres above sea level, which commenced operations in 1998 and the latest recorded data in 2021, we can measure the temperature fluctuations that will affect the heating and cooling requirements of your home.

Black Hill experiences summers that have reached up to 44.9 degrees C and winters that have been as cold as 1 degrees C, showcasing the need for versatile HVAC systems. In January, temperatures often there are on average 11.6 days over 30 degrees C, while July sees an average of 0.3 days less than 2 degrees C. These fluctuations underscore the importance of a reliable air conditioning service that can handle both extremes.

In the hotter months, we notice an average humidity level around 72% at 9am and 57% at 3pm, which can significantly impact home comfort on hot days. So a well-rounded Aircon system won't just keep your home cool, it will also help manage these humidity levels. Additionally, Black Hill experiences wind speeds of up to 6 km/h, making a smart HVAC system, Split System Air Conditioner, Evaporative Cooler, or Ducted Air Conditioning that can adjust to external factors an excellent investment.

Demographics

Black Hill and the postcode of 2322 has a total 8656 occupied dwellings. Of these dwellings in Black Hill 8083 are houses, 428 are semi-detached or townhouses, and 69 are flats or apartments. We see that homes of 4 or more bedrooms in size are 48% of all dwellings, while 3 bedroom homes are 39%, and 2 or fewer bedroom dwellings are 11%. According to the Australian Bureau of Statistics 1% of census results did not specify the number of bedrooms

Typically we see that the bigger the home, then the more it costs to heat and cool, and with 2.7 number of people per household and with 69% of properties mortgaged or owned outright in 2322, investing in energy-efficient air conditioning will make a significant difference to energy savings here.

* Based on Australian Bureau of Statistics 2021 Data

About Black Hill

Black Hill, located in NSW 2322, experiences a temperate climate with warm summers and mild winters. The average maximum temperature ranges from 20°C to 30°C throughout the year. The hottest months are typically January and February, with average maximum temperatures reaching around 30°C. With such warm temperatures, reliable cooling solutions are essential for the comfort of residents in Black Hill.

When it comes to cooling requirements, split system air-conditioning units are an ideal choice for Black Hill. Split systems provide efficient cooling by circulating cool air throughout the room, ensuring a comfortable environment even during the hottest months. Additionally, split systems offer the advantage of being able to provide both heating and cooling, making them a versatile option for year-round comfort.

Considering the possibility of using solar power to power the unit, Black Hill residents can benefit from reduced energy costs and environmental sustainability. By harnessing the power of the sun, solar-powered split system air-conditioning units can significantly lower electricity bills while minimizing the carbon footprint.
